Swim Lessons Learning Objectives – Prerequisites
Beginners – Level 1 Level 2 Fully submerge head and retrieve underwater objects Explore deep water with support Demonstrate unsupported front and back float or glide Level off from a vertical position Demonstrate rhythmic breathing Demonstrate step-in entry and side exit Perform flutter kick on front and back Demonstrate finning on back Perform combined stroke on front and back Demonstrate turning over, back to front and front to back Float in life jacket with face out of water Perform reaching and extension assists from deck Become familiar with rescue breathing Level 3 Retrieve object, unsupported, with eyes open Demonstrate bobbing Jump into deep water from side of pool with life jacket on Learn the basic rules of safe diving Dive from the side of the pool (if water depth permits) in kneeling and compact positions Demonstrate gliding with push-off Coordinate the components of the front crawl and back crawl Demonstrate the fundamentals of elementary backstroke and treading water Reverse direction while swimming on front and back Become familiar with the H.E.L.P. and huddle positions Learn how to open airway for rescue breathing Level 4 Demonstrate deep-water bobbing Demonstrate rotary breathing Dive from the side of the pool (if water depth permits) from stride and standing positions Build endurance by swimming elementary backstroke, front crawl, back crawl, and elementary backstroke at increased distances. Learn the basics of breaststroke, side stroke, and turning at the wall Learn alternate kicks for treading water Learn rescue-breathing techniques Become familiar with CPR Level 5 Demonstrate alternate breathing Dive from diving board Demonstrate stride jump entry Demonstrate long shallow dive Perform the front crawl, back crawl, and elementary backstroke for increased distances Perform the sidestroke and the breaststroke and swim under water Perform open turn on front and back Learn the basic safety rules for diving from a board Recognize the signs of spinal injury Perform feet-first surface dive Learn the dolphin kick Increase endurance and skill in treading water Level 6 Demonstrate approach and hurdle on diving board Demonstrate jump tuck from diving board Enhance ability to perform strokes introduced at previous levels Perform approach stroke Demonstrate breaststroke and sidestroke turns, speed turn and pullout for breaststroke, and flip turn for front crawl Perform tuck and pike surface dives Learn alternate kicks for treading water Demonstrate a throwing rescue Roll spinal injury victim face up Level 7 Incorporate Learn to Swim skills and activities into lifetime fitness habits Perform springboard dives in tuck and pike positions Swim continuously for 500 yards, using any combination of strokes Perform backstroke flip turn Perform in-water rescue using equipment Become aware of conditioning principles Check heart rate Retrieve diving brick from 8-10 feet of water Review Basic Water Safety skills Tread water for 5 minutes Assist with backboard rescue Explore alternative aquatic activities |
